Unleash Your Potential with Caffeine to Enhance Energy and Focus in Powerlifting

Athlete lifting weights, energised by caffeine's focus-enhancing aura.

Caffeine emerges as a significant player in the domain of pre-workout supplements, celebrated for its extraordinary capacity to boost alertness and elevate energy levels. For athletes gearing up for powerlifting meets, this dynamic stimulant can dramatically enhance performance, especially when every fraction of a second is vital. Scientific research highlights that caffeine can substantially increase strength output, establishing it as an indispensable factor for heavy lifts where unwavering focus and energy are paramount. It works by inhibiting adenosine, a neurotransmitter associated with relaxation and drowsiness, thus triggering an increased release of adrenaline and a powerful surge of energy for athletes.

In addition to physical boosts, caffeine has the remarkable ability to modify the perception of exertion, empowering powerlifters to push beyond fatigue and lift heavier weights. To optimise results, the timing of caffeine consumption is crucial; ideally, it should be taken approximately 30 to 60 minutes prior to competition to maximise its effectiveness, directing extra energy into lifts. Studies suggest that a dosage of about 3-6 mg of caffeine per kilogram of body weight can significantly improve performance metrics. By employing strategic supplementation methods, powerlifters can attain peak performance levels, particularly in competitive scenarios where every lift is crucial for success.

Amplify Your Training Intensity with Beta-Alanine for Superior Performance

beta-alanine is a remarkable amino acid recognised for its pivotal role in boosting athletic performance, particularly within the powerlifting community. By elevating carnosine levels in muscles, beta-alanine serves as an effective buffer against acid accumulation during intense workouts. This buffering action significantly reduces fatigue, enabling athletes to train with greater intensity and for extended durations, which is essential for achieving peak performance in powerlifting.

Numerous studies have demonstrated that beta-alanine supplementation can lead to substantial enhancements in exercise capacity, particularly during high-intensity tasks such as powerlifting. As lifts approach maximum intensity, the ability to delay fatigue can be the decisive factor separating success from failure. Athletes across the globe, whether training in cutting-edge gyms or local powerlifting clubs, can harness the benefits of this supplement to shatter their limits and achieve outstanding results.

Maximising the benefits of beta-alanine hinges on effective timing and dosage. Continuous supplementation over several weeks is advisable to sufficiently elevate muscle carnosine levels. Powerlifters should aim for a daily intake of 2-5 grams, ideally split into smaller doses to minimise potential side effects, such as the tingling sensation known as paresthesia.

Integrating beta-alanine into a pre-workout strategy not only enhances physical performance but also bolsters mental stamina, allowing lifters to sustain focus and energy throughout demanding training sessions and competitions. Boost Strength and Recovery with Creatine Supplementation

Creatine is widely acknowledged as one of the most extensively researched supplements within the realm of sports nutrition, particularly valued by the powerlifting community. It functions by increasing phosphocreatine reserves in muscles, facilitating the rapid regeneration of ATP—the primary energy source essential for cellular functions. This enhancement in energy availability translates to improved strength and power output, which are vital for executing heavy lifts and explosive movements characteristic of powerlifting meets.

A wealth of studies has confirmed that creatine supplementation can lead to significant increases in maximal strength, empowering athletes to lift heavier weights with greater efficiency. For powerlifters, the capacity to generate substantial force rapidly can distinguish personal bests from missed opportunities, especially in competitive settings where every lift is critical.

Athletes worldwide have adopted diverse creatine supplementation strategies, including loading phases and maintenance dosages. A common approach involves initiating a loading phase of 20 grams daily for 5-7 days, followed by a maintenance dose of 3-5 grams each day. This regimen effectively saturates muscles with creatine, leading to profound benefits once established.

Moreover, creatine is not solely focused on augmenting strength; it also plays a significant role in recovery. After intense training sessions, creatine aids in muscle repair, ensuring lifters can recover swiftly and be ready for subsequent workouts. Enhance Blood Flow and Overall Performance with Citrulline Malate

Powerlifter mid-lift, muscles pumped with enhanced blood flow, surrounded by nitric oxide glow, apples in background.

Citrulline malate has emerged as a powerful supplement designed to optimise performance during high-intensity workouts, particularly in the context of powerlifting. This compound combines the amino acid citrulline with malate, a component derived from apples. Its primary function is to elevate nitric oxide production within the body, resulting in improved blood flow and enhanced muscle oxygenation.

For powerlifters, the implications of improved blood circulation are profound. Enhanced blood flow not only facilitates the delivery of essential nutrients to muscles but also aids in alleviating muscle soreness during and after demanding lifting sessions. Research indicates that citrulline malate can also diminish fatigue, allowing athletes to prolong their workout sessions and effectively push their boundaries.

Timing plays a crucial role in the efficacy of citrulline malate. For optimal results, consuming approximately 6-8 grams about an hour before training can significantly enhance performance, especially during powerlifting competitions where stamina and strength must be consistently maintained across multiple lifts.

Accelerate Muscle Recovery with BCAAs Throughout Your Training

Branched-Chain Amino Acids (BCAAs) are vital components for muscle recovery and overall athletic performance, particularly during prolonged training sessions and competitions such as powerlifting meets. Comprising the three essential amino acids—leucine, isoleucine, and valine—BCAAs facilitate muscle repair while minimising muscle breakdown. This is especially critical for powerlifters who adhere to demanding training regimens, where muscle preservation is paramount.

BCAAs function by promoting protein synthesis and reducing protein degradation rates during exercise, which allows athletes to maintain muscle mass while pushing their physical limits. Research indicates that supplementation can significantly relieve muscle soreness post-workout, enabling lifters to recover more efficiently between training sessions and competitions. This is particularly advantageous for powerlifters who train intensely multiple times a week, whether in bustling urban gyms or isolated training facilities.

Intra-workout supplementation of BCAAs can also enhance endurance, empowering athletes to sustain their strength and performance throughout extended lifting sessions. The recommended dosages typically range from 5 to 20 grams during workouts, depending on the individual's body weight and exercise intensity.

Ensure Proper Hydration with Essential Electrolyte Supplements

Powerlifter in hot gym, sweating, drinking electrolyte-rich sports drink, focused, surrounded by weights and global competition banner.

Maintaining proper hydration is fundamental to athletic performance, and sustaining an appropriate electrolyte balance is crucial for powerlifters, especially during intense lifting sessions. Electrolytes, including sodium, potassium, calcium, and magnesium, play a vital role in regulating fluid balance, muscle contractions, and nerve signalling. For powerlifters competing on a global stage, staying adequately hydrated can unlock peak performance.

During strenuous workouts, particularly in hot environments or lengthy competitions, athletes can lose substantial amounts of electrolytes through sweat. This loss can lead to muscle cramps, fatigue, and diminished performance. Supplementing with electrolytes can effectively restore balance, ensuring lifters can perform at their best.

Research indicates that electrolyte supplementation can enhance endurance and reduce the risk of muscle cramps, allowing athletes to focus entirely on their lifting. Practically, this means that powerlifters should consider integrating electrolyte drinks or tablets into their intra-workout routine, especially during competitions where hydration options may be limited.

Effective electrolyte management can also aid in recovery. Post-training, replenishing lost electrolytes can shorten recovery time, ensuring that lifters are prepared for their next session. Fuel Your Training with Carbohydrates for Sustained Energy

Carbohydrates serve as the primary energy source for the body, particularly during high-intensity activities such as powerlifting. For athletes preparing for powerlifting meets, ensuring adequate carbohydrate intake is crucial to fuel muscles and maintain strength throughout demanding lifts.

During intense lifting sessions, carbohydrates are consumed rapidly, necessitating the provision of quick energy sources through intra-workout supplements. Consuming carbohydrates during workouts can help sustain energy levels, allowing lifters to uphold their strength and performance. Research suggests that ingesting 30-60 grams of carbohydrates per hour during prolonged exercise can significantly boost endurance and power output.

Sports drinks, gels, or easily digestible carbohydrate-rich snacks can serve as effective intra-workout options. For powerlifters, timing carbohydrate intake is vital. Ingesting simple carbohydrates during lifting sessions can ensure that energy levels remain elevated, particularly during competitions when fatigue can set in swiftly.

Beyond enhancing immediate performance, adequate carbohydrate intake can facilitate recovery post-workout. By replenishing glycogen stores, powerlifters can ensure they are ready for their next training session, whether it’s the day after or later in the week. Support Muscle Growth and Recovery with Protein Intake

Post-workout nutrition is crucial for all athletes, but for powerlifters, the emphasis on protein is particularly paramount. Protein is essential for muscle repair and growth, establishing itself as a cornerstone of recovery following intense lifting sessions. Consuming an adequate amount of protein post-workout can stimulate muscle protein synthesis, ensuring that the effort invested in lifting translates into tangible gains.

Research indicates that consuming 20-40 grams of high-quality protein shortly after workouts can enhance recovery and promote muscle growth. For powerlifters, protein sources can range from whey protein shakes to whole foods like chicken, fish, or legumes. The choice of protein can vary based on individual preferences and dietary restrictions, yet the objective remains consistent: to supply the body with the necessary building blocks for recovery.

Optimize Recovery with Glutamine for Enhanced Muscle Repair

Glutamine is an amino acid that plays a critical role in muscle recovery, making it particularly beneficial for powerlifters during the post-workout phase. After intense lifting sessions, the body’s glutamine levels can deplete, potentially hindering recovery and immune function. Supplementing with glutamine can help restore these levels, ensuring that athletes can recover effectively.

Research has shown that glutamine supplementation can alleviate muscle soreness and improve recovery time, enabling lifters to train consistently without prolonged downtime. For powerlifters, faster recovery means being able to return to the gym for their next heavy lift sooner, which is vital for maintaining training momentum.

The recommended dosage for glutamine supplementation typically ranges from 5 to 10 grams after workouts. This can be taken in powder form mixed with water or incorporated into post-workout shakes. The convenience of glutamine supplementation makes it a popular choice among powerlifters looking to enhance their recovery protocols.

Moreover, glutamine may also strengthen immune health, which is particularly crucial for athletes who subject their bodies to intense physical stress. Enhance Energy Metabolism and Recovery with L-Carnitine

L-Carnitine is a compound that plays a vital role in energy metabolism, aiding in the transportation of fatty acids into the mitochondria for energy production. For powerlifters, L-Carnitine can enhance recovery and improve overall performance, making it a valuable addition to post-workout supplementation.

Research suggests that L-Carnitine may contribute to reduced muscle soreness and improved recovery following strenuous training. By promoting efficient recovery, athletes can train more effectively and maintain their strength during subsequent workouts. This is crucial for powerlifters, who often face demanding training schedules and need to ensure they are prepared for heavy lifts.

Typical dosages of L-Carnitine range from 1 to 3 grams post-workout, with some athletes opting for additional doses throughout the day. The versatility of L-Carnitine supplementation allows powerlifters to easily incorporate it into their nutritional plans, whether through capsules or liquid forms.

Moreover, L-Carnitine may present additional advantages for body composition, helping athletes manage their weight while preserving muscle mass. This makes it particularly appealing for powerlifters aiming to compete in specific weight classes. Combat Inflammation and Promote Recovery with Omega-3 Fatty Acids

Omega-3 fatty acids are essential fats recognised for their anti-inflammatory properties, rendering them invaluable for recovery among powerlifters. The rigours of intense training can lead to muscle inflammation and soreness, hindering performance and recovery. By integrating omega-3 fatty acids into their diets, powerlifters can mitigate these effects and promote joint health.

Research has demonstrated that omega-3 supplementation can decrease muscle soreness and stiffness following workouts, allowing athletes to recover more efficiently. This is particularly beneficial for powerlifters who engage in heavy lifting, where joint stress is a frequent concern. By supporting a healthier inflammatory response, omega-3s can empower athletes to maintain consistent training, which is essential for long-term success.

Common sources of omega-3s include fish oil supplements and plant-based options such as flaxseed oil. For optimal benefits, a daily intake of 1-3 grams of omega-3s is recommended. Accelerate Recovery and Reduce Inflammation with Turmeric

Turmeric, a spice renowned for its anti-inflammatory properties, has carved its niche in the supplement routines of numerous athletes, including powerlifters. Curcumin, the active compound in turmeric, has been shown to alleviate muscle soreness and expedite recovery, making it an invaluable addition to post-workout nutrition.

Research indicates that turmeric can reduce markers of inflammation and muscle damage, which is particularly beneficial for powerlifters subjected to frequent intense training sessions. Incorporating turmeric into a post-workout routine can help athletes recover more swiftly, enabling them to sustain their training intensity and concentration as they prepare for powerlifting meets.

For optimal absorption, turmeric is frequently consumed in conjunction with black pepper extract (biperine), which significantly enhances its bioavailability. Powerlifters can ingest turmeric in various formats, including capsules, powders, or as a spice in meals. A daily dosage of around 500-2000 mg of curcumin is typically recommended for beneficial effects.

Enhance Muscle Recovery and Relaxation with Magnesium

Magnesium plays a crucial role in muscle relaxation and recovery, making it an essential supplement for powerlifters. After intense lifting sessions, muscles can become tense and cramp, delaying recovery and hindering future performance. Magnesium helps alleviate these issues by promoting muscle relaxation and minimising the likelihood of cramping.

Research suggests that maintaining adequate magnesium levels can support muscle function and recovery, enabling athletes to train more effectively and consistently. Powerlifters, particularly those who engage in high-volume training, can greatly benefit from magnesium supplementation, as it aids in muscle relaxation and overall recovery.

The recommended daily intake for magnesium varies, but athletes typically require around 400-600 mg, depending on factors such as training intensity and personal dietary habits. Magnesium can be sourced from various foods, including leafy greens, nuts, seeds, and supplements.

Incorporating magnesium into a post-workout strategy can also enhance sleep quality, which is crucial for recovery. Athletes who enjoy restful sleep are better equipped to handle the physical and mental demands of powerlifting. Boost Strength and Muscular Endurance with HMB Supplementation

Beta-Hydroxy Beta-Methylbutyrate (HMB) has emerged as a powerful supplement for athletes striving to enhance strength and minimise muscle breakdown. For powerlifters, HMB can be particularly advantageous, as it helps preserve lean muscle mass while promoting recovery, thus allowing athletes to maintain strength during rigorous training regimens.

Research demonstrates that HMB can lead to substantial improvements in muscle strength and size, making it an appealing option for powerlifters aiming for peak performance. By reducing muscle protein breakdown, HMB enables lifters to endure demanding workouts without sacrificing their hard-earned muscle mass.

Typical doses of HMB range from 3 to 6 grams daily, ideally taken in divided doses throughout the day. This supplementation strategy helps maximise the benefits of HMB while minimising any potential side effects. Powerlifters globally have integrated HMB into their training protocols, recognising its role in facilitating strength gains and recovery.

Moreover, HMB may also enhance recovery following intense exercise, allowing lifters to return to training sooner. This reduction in recovery time can result in more consistent training sessions, which is vital for athletes preparing for competitions. Enhance Muscle Performance with Arginine for Optimal Blood Flow

Arginine is another potent amino acid that stimulates nitric oxide production, leading to improved blood flow and muscle performance. For powerlifters, this results in enhanced muscle pumps, increased endurance, and improved overall performance during lifts. Research suggests that arginine can also assist in the recovery process, making it a dual-purpose supplement.

By promoting blood flow, arginine facilitates the delivery of essential nutrients to working muscles, reducing fatigue and allowing athletes to maintain intensity throughout their workouts. For powerlifters, this can translate into sustained higher performance levels during prolonged lifting sessions, which is critical for achieving personal bests and competitive success.

Recommended dosages for arginine supplementation typically range from 3 to 6 grams before workouts. This can be taken in powder form mixed with water or included in pre-workout stacks. Support Joint Integrity with Glucosamine for Enhanced Mobility

Glucosamine is a vital supplement recognised for its role in promoting joint health, making it essential for powerlifters engaged in heavy lifting. The stress and strain placed on joints during intense training sessions necessitate maintaining joint integrity for optimal performance and long-term health.

Research indicates that glucosamine supplementation can alleviate joint pain and improve overall joint function. For powerlifters, who are at risk of joint wear and tear due to the repetitive nature of their sport, incorporating glucosamine can be a proactive strategy to protect their joints.

The typical dosage for glucosamine ranges from 1500 to 2000 mg daily, often divided into smaller doses for improved absorption. As athletes worldwide experience the benefits of glucosamine, it has become a staple in the training regimens of powerlifters striving to maintain their competitive edge.

In addition to pain relief, glucosamine contributes to improved joint flexibility, enabling lifters to perform their lifts with greater ease and efficiency. The implications of this are significant; enhanced joint function can lead to more effective training sessions, ultimately translating into better performance during competitions.

Enhance Joint Resilience with Chondroitin for Optimal Mobility

Chondroitin often complements glucosamine in supporting joint health, providing additional benefits for powerlifters. Similar to glucosamine, chondroitin is a natural compound found in cartilage and has been shown to help maintain joint integrity and resilience under pressure.

Research suggests that chondroitin supplementation can alleviate joint pain and improve mobility, making it particularly advantageous for powerlifters who subject their joints to heavy loads during lifts. The combination of glucosamine and chondroitin can create a synergistic effect, enhancing the overall efficacy of joint support.

Typical dosages for chondroitin range from 1000 to 1200 mg daily, often taken alongside glucosamine for optimal results. Powerlifters globally have embraced this combination as a foundational aspect of their joint health strategy, recognising its importance in sustaining long-term performance.

Maintaining joint health is crucial for powerlifters, as joint issues can lead to interruptions in training and competition. By integrating chondroitin into their recovery regimens, athletes can ensure they are better prepared to handle the physical demands of their sport, ultimately enhancing their capability to compete at high levels.

Strengthen Bones and Prevent Injuries with Calcium for Optimal Performance

Calcium is a fundamental mineral crucial for bone health, and its importance cannot be overstated for powerlifters. Strong bones are essential for supporting the heavy loads lifted during training and competitions, making calcium supplementation a key consideration for athletes aiming to uphold skeletal integrity.

Research shows that adequate calcium intake is vital for preventing injuries and maintaining bone density, particularly in strength athletes who exert significant stress on their skeletal systems. Powerlifters can benefit from supplemental calcium, enhancing their overall bone health and resilience.

The recommended daily intake of calcium typically ranges from 1000 to 1300 mg, depending on age and gender. Dairy products are common sources, but athletes may also consider fortified foods or calcium supplements to meet their needs, especially if they adhere to a plant-based diet.

Incorporating calcium into a powerlifter’s diet is not solely about injury prevention; it also supports muscle contraction and nerve function, contributing to overall athletic performance. Boost Mental Clarity and Focus with Rhodiola Rosea for Enhanced Performance

Rhodiola Rosea is an adaptogenic herb that has gained traction among athletes for its ability to enhance mental focus and manage stress. For powerlifters, the mental aspect of competition is as critical as physical strength, making Rhodiola an invaluable addition to their supplement arsenal.

Research suggests that Rhodiola can enhance cognitive function and reduce fatigue, enabling athletes to maintain focus during intense training sessions and competitions. For powerlifters, the ability to stay mentally sharp can be the distinguishing factor between a successful lift and a missed attempt.

Typical dosages of Rhodiola range from 200 to 600 mg per day, often taken in the morning or about 30 minutes before training. Powerlifters across various regions have incorporated Rhodiola into their mental preparation strategies, leveraging its benefits to enhance performance under pressure.

In addition to cognitive benefits, Rhodiola can aid in regulating stress hormones, allowing athletes to approach competitions with greater calm and clarity. This aspect is particularly significant in powerlifting, where the psychological demands can heavily influence performance outcomes.

Reduce Stress Levels and Enhance Focus with Ashwagandha for Better Performance

Ashwagandha is another powerful adaptogen that provides numerous benefits for powerlifters, particularly in managing stress and enhancing mental clarity. Research indicates that ashwagandha can help lower cortisol levels, a hormone associated with stress, which can otherwise impede performance and recovery.

For powerlifters, effectively managing stress is crucial, as it can impact both physical performance and mental focus. Ashwagandha supplementation fosters a sense of calm, enabling athletes to concentrate fully on their lifts and training regimens.

Typical dosages of ashwagandha range from 300 to 600 mg daily, often taken in capsule or powder form. By incorporating this adaptogen into their daily routines, powerlifters can cultivate a more resilient mindset, enhancing their capacity to perform under pressure during competitions.

Moreover, ashwagandha may also bolster physical performance by improving strength and endurance, making it a multifaceted supplement for those engaged in heavy lifting. Enhance Focus and Relaxation with L-Theanine for Improved Performance

L-Theanine, an amino acid found primarily in green tea, is recognised for its relaxing properties without inducing drowsiness. For powerlifters, incorporating L-Theanine into their supplement regimen can enhance focus and alleviate anxiety, particularly in high-pressure situations such as competitions.

Research indicates that L-Theanine can promote a state of relaxation while simultaneously improving cognitive performance. This dual action is especially beneficial for powerlifters, who need to maintain mental clarity and focus during heavy lifts while managing the stress associated with competition.

Typical dosages for L-Theanine range from 100 to 200 mg, often taken alongside caffeine to amplify its effects. Powerlifters can benefit from this combination, as it promotes alertness without the jitters frequently associated with caffeine alone.

Enhance Mental Resilience and Focus with Bacopa Monnieri for Optimal Performance

Bacopa Monnieri is an adaptogenic herb celebrated for its cognitive-enhancing properties, making it a valuable supplement for powerlifters seeking to boost their mental focus and resilience against stress. Research suggests that Bacopa can improve cognitive function and memory, enabling athletes to remain focused during intense training and competitive scenarios.

For powerlifters, sustaining mental acuity is crucial, especially when facing the psychological demands of lifting heavy weights. Bacopa Monnieri can aid in supporting mental clarity, allowing athletes to concentrate fully on their lifts and execute them with precision.

Typical dosages of Bacopa range from 300 to 600 mg daily, often consumed with meals for optimal absorption. By incorporating Bacopa into their supplement regimens, powerlifters can foster a sharper mental state, enhancing their ability to perform under pressure.

Furthermore, Bacopa Monnieri may help alleviate anxiety, creating a calmer mindset for competition. Boost Energy and Focus with Ginseng for Enhanced Performance

Ginseng is a renowned herb celebrated for its capacity to enhance mental performance and reduce fatigue. For powerlifters, integrating ginseng into their supplement regimen can elevate focus and energy levels, particularly during demanding training sessions and competitions.

Research indicates that ginseng can improve cognitive function and physical performance, allowing athletes to maintain heightened levels of concentration throughout their workouts. For powerlifters, this can lead to more effective training sessions and improved performance during competitions.

Typical dosages for ginseng range from 200 to 400 mg daily, available in various forms including capsules and powders. Powerlifters globally have recognised ginseng’s benefits, incorporating it into their routines as they prepare for powerlifting meets.

Additionally, ginseng may help recovery by reducing inflammation and oxidative stress, ensuring athletes can bounce back more swiftly after intense workouts. Enhance Health and Performance with Comprehensive Multivitamins

Multivitamins play an integral role in supporting overall health and performance, particularly for athletes engaged in rigorous training like powerlifters. Given the physical demands of lifting heavy weights, ensuring a comprehensive intake of essential vitamins and minerals becomes crucial for maintaining optimal performance levels.

Research indicates that multivitamins can assist in filling nutritional gaps in an athlete’s diet, providing essential nutrients that support energy production, muscle function, and recovery. For powerlifters, a robust multivitamin can enhance overall health, ensuring they are equipped to cope with the stresses of training and competition.

While numerous multivitamin formulations are available, athletes should seek those specifically designed for active individuals, containing key ingredients like B vitamins, vitamin D, magnesium, and zinc. This targeted approach can better address the unique needs of powerlifters.

Incorporating a multivitamin into a daily routine can also bolster immune health, which is crucial for athletes who subject their bodies to intense physical stress. Maintaining robust immune function ensures that powerlifters can train consistently without interruptions due to illness.
